Scorpius was an alien insectoid warlord, ruler of the inhabitants of the Scorpion Stinger and the main antagonist of the first half of Power Rangers Lost Galaxy.

History

He resembled a large arachnid with tentacles instead of legs. He was a truly antagonistic enemy of the Magna Defender, having attacked his planet 3,000 years ago and killed his only son, Zika.

Scorpius frequently attempted to gather powerful objects to himself, including the Quasar Sabers and the Lights of Orion. The result of these mad quests often left the objects in question in the hands of the Galaxy Power Rangers, and severely depleted Scorpius' army as they were either punished by him, or destroyed by the Rangers.

Scorpius had a daughter, Trakeena, upon whom he truly doted and adored. He refused to allow her to be involved in his evil deeds, and he would not allow her to engage the Rangers in battle despite her requests - all in attempts to protect her from becoming severely injured.

Eventually, Scorpius webbed a cocoon for his daughter. He told her that it was her time to enter the cocoon, to shed her mortal beauty and become an insect with magnificent powers, like him. With the help of the cocoon, Scorpius likely would have let Trakeena fight the rangers. Trakeena declined, for vanity reasons. When Scorpius tried to force her, she ran away and teleported out into space, eventually arriving on Onyx.

PR LG07 E21 HeirToTheThrone NM314 WithRecap.mov

Death of Scorpius.

Scorpius had later met Deviot and appointed him as his new general. Deviot plotted against Scorpius, to depose him and enter the cocoon so that he could gain great powers. Deviot tricked Scorpius into attacking the Galaxy Power Rangers, saying that Trakeena was their prisoner. With an army of Stingwingers, Scorpius ambushed the Galaxy Rangers. Alone he proved to be a formidable force to be reckon with in battle. However, grabbing on his tentacles, the other rangers held the warlord down to allow Leo to deliver the final strike with his charged-up Quasar Saber and Power-Up Claw. Though Scorpius was mortally wounded, he survived long enough to flee back to the Scorpion Stinger. Trakeena returned to take his throne before Scorpius could pass it to Deviot. Before he died, Scorpius told Deviot to be as loyal to Trakeena as he had been to him. After he died, one of Scorpius's tentacles transformed into a new, more powerful staff for Trakeena.

Personality

When it comes to the conquest of the galaxy, Scorpius is a cold and ruthless warlord as shown when he destroys the Magna Defender's home planet and mercilessly kills his son Zika, when the latter tries to attack him.

He is a very strict father when it came to his daughter Trakeena, as shown when he gets angry at Trakeena due to her not wanting to enter the Cocoon out of fear for her beauty, to the point he tries to force her to enter, only for her to escape the Scorpion Stinger and flee to Onyx and be trained by Villamax shortly afterwards.

Despite this strictness however, he truly cared for her as he will often not let her be involved in his evil acts out of fear for her safety. This soon became apparent in "Heir to the Throne" when he thought the Rangers kidnapped her due to manipulation by Deviot, he then promptly went to Terra Venture and confronted the Rangers himself, and angrily demanded to know where Trakeena was. He refused to listen to the Rangers when they legitimately had no idea what he was talking about and attacked them, which led to his destruction and death at the hands of Leo Corbett.

Etymology

In keeping with the galaxy theme of this season, Scorpius was named after the constellation of the same name.

Notes

  • When Scorpius was invading the Magna Defender's home planet 3,000 years ago, among the monsters he brought with him were Radster, Sledge, Fishface, Impostra, and Motor Mantis, and Captain Mutiny.
  • Scorpius is American-produced and therefore has no direct Sentai counterpart.
  • The goo slime covering Scorpius is made from varnishing cream.
  • He shares his name with a constellation, though unlike an actual scorpion, he has six legs instead of eight.
  • Scorpius was possibly the fifth strongest monster throughout Power Rangers Lost Galaxy, the fourth are Barbarax and Deviot, the third is Villamax, the second being Captain Mutiny and the strongest being his daughter Trakeena.
  • Scorpius is the first main villain to be killed at the hands of the Rangers instead of an interdimensional energy wave.
  • It is implied that he once had a humanoid appearance like Trakeena and entered a cocoon like the one he made for her when he was her age and shedded his skin to become a powerful Insectoid, as he mentioned that transforming into a powerful metamorphosis was something they “all” had had to do, the “all” presumably being their ancestors, and him himself.
